Transaction 2d9cf91c60f30896e994b77075e38f8e0ebabfc5cecf71a569fd77a50d28dd95

1 Input
2 Outputs
  • 2d9cf91c60f30896e994b77075e38f8e0ebabfc5cecf71a569fd77a50d28dd95:0
  • value  11363359
    address  17PcWFUfTxXQKhknUAfXjuJmdPa9HXrrNX
  • 2d9cf91c60f30896e994b77075e38f8e0ebabfc5cecf71a569fd77a50d28dd95:1
  • value  331578
    address  3LGbGGwEC61VshqHYWYqy7irnCx8V15wQj